Fast food is expensive in California. These states are pricier

California ranks among the most expensive U.S. states for – well, pretty much everything. So it probably won’t come as a surprise that the Golden State is among the costliest in the nation when it comes to ordering fast food takeout.

A new study conducted by BravoDeal, an online coupons site, looked at the prices of specific menu items at four fast food chains: McDonald’s, Domino’s Pizza, Chick-fil-A and Taco Bell.

It found the most expensive takeout is in Hawaii, where a Domino’s medium cheese pizza costs an average of $18.99, a McDonald’s Big Mac is $5.31, a Chick-fil-A chicken sandwich is $4.06, and a Taco Bell combo meal is $7.70.

California ranked fourth behind New York and New Jersey. The study found that in California, customers pay an average of $14.99 for a Domino’s medium cheese pizza, and a McDonald’s Big Mac costs $5.11.

The average cost of each food item was scored out of ten and averaged to produce the rankings.

On the opposite end of the spectrum, BravoDeal found three southern U.S. states, Mississippi, Arkansas and Alabama, have the cheapest takeout fast food.

Prices at many California fast-food restaurants have increased since the state boosted the minimum wage for quick-service restaurant workers from $16 to $20 an hour on April 1.

According to data from market research firm Datassential, fast food and fast-casual restaurants in the Golden State have raised menu prices by 10% overall.

Another analysis found Chick-fil-A raised prices by 10.6% between Feb. 15 and April 15, Starbucks raised them by 7.8%, Shake Shack by 7.7%, Chipotle by 6.9% and Taco Bell by 4.1%.
